Fission Intersects 12.5m @ 2.49% U3O8 With Assays to 11.1% U3O8 at PLS

05.12.2012  |  Marketwire

KELOWNA, BRITISH COLUMBIA -- (Marketwire) -- 12/05/12 -- Fission Energy Corp. ("Fission" or "the Company) (TSX VENTURE: FIS)(OTCQX: FSSIF), and its 50% Joint Venture (JV) partner Alpha Minerals Inc. ("Alpha"), are pleased to report assay results from the recently completed drill program (see news release Nov. 15, 2012) on its Patterson Lake South (PLS) Property.


Composited drill hole mineralized intersections include:



-- Hole PLS12-024: 18.0m @ 1.78% U3O8 from 65.0m to 83.0m
-- including 12.5m @ 2.49% U3O8
-- including 3.5m @ 4.33% U3O8
-- including 0.50m @ 11.1% U3O8
-- Hole PLS12-022: 8.5m @ 1.07% U3O8 from 70.5m to 79m
-- including 2.5m @ 2.63% U3O8
-- Hole PLS12-025: 22.5m @ 0.4% U3O8 from 60.5m to 83.0m
-- including 4.03m @ 0.85% U3O8
-- Hole PLS12-023: 9.5m @ 0.27% U3O8 from 66.5m to 76.0m


The 9 hole 1,631.86m core drilling program focused on the partially tested PL-3B EM Conductor, in addition to other untested parallel east-northeast trending EM conductors, which lie approximately 3.0 km to the east of the high grade uranium boulder field reported in July of last year (see news release July 27, 2011), where multiple boulder assays were recorded as high as 39.6% U3O8.

Composited U3O8 mineralized intervals are summarized below. The 4 mineralized holes show that the uranium is concentrated primarily at the same shallow depth between 57.5m to 92.5m in basement graphitic metapelitic lithology and with continuous substantial widths. Uranium concentration is well developed throughout the mineralized sections with assays being relatively consistent throughout.

Drill core samples were analyzed by SRC Geoanalytical Laboratories (an SCC ISO/IEC 17025: 2005 Accredited Facility) of Saskatoon for assay analysis, which included a 63 element ICP-OES, uranium by fluorimetry (partial digestion).


Patterson Lake South Property


The 31,039 hectare PLS project is a 50%/50% Joint Venture held by Fission Energy Corp. and Alpha Minerals Inc (AMW). Fission is the Operator. PLS is accessible by road with primary access from all-weather Highway 955, which runs north to the former Cluff Lake mine, (greater than 60M lbs of U3O8 produced), and passes through the nearby UEX-Areva Shea Creek discoveries located 50km to the north, currently under active exploration and development and with resource of approximately 88M lbs of U3O8.
